Prelude

它是一个高度可配置的开箱即用的Emacs配置文件集合.

开启里面的modules

默认情况下, 安装好 prelude 是没有开启它的模块功能的,要开启自己想要的模块, 可以按以下做:

cd ~/.eamcs.d/
cp sample/prelude-modules.el .
emacs prelude-modules.el

然后按里面的模块, 根据自己的需要, 去开启或者关闭.

自定义自己的额外配置

将自己的配置文件放到 ~/.emacs.d/personal/preload/ 目录下即可.

例如, 我有一个配置文件 ~/.emacs.d/personal/preload/yang.el , 这样子 prelude 就会自动加载这个配置文件了.

我刚开始做 prelude , 我只是暂时添加了自己喜欢的主题, yang.el 的内容就只有以下一行:

(setq prelude-theme 'solarized-dark)

注意, 默认情况下, prelude 并没有安装这个主题, 所以先要安装下这个主题先:

M-x package-install RET solarized-theme

注意

为了升级方便, 其他地方的文件自己不要随便添加或者修改, 最好按 prelude 的约定来做:

  • ~/.emacs.d/prelude-modules.el : 这里开启或关闭自己需要的模块.

  • ~/.emacs.d/personal/preload/ : 这个目录,存放自定义的配置文件.